Output f81241cc85f4debdab776e052a4bc9531788ddbd656bbade1c387bfd3143681b:3

value
26038611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08fd550b18246aa89e806ca2a50c4bcda7884bd2 OP_EQUAL
address
M8ih7o3eDWhSMaZCcNHE7er8WaWqyQZWDf
transaction
f81241cc85f4debdab776e052a4bc9531788ddbd656bbade1c387bfd3143681b
spent
true